Cost of living in Bochum is very similar to The Hague (without rent).
Rent in Bochum is 37% cheaper than in The Hague.
Cost of living including rent in Bochum is 23% lower than in The Hague.
Food in Bochum is 5% more expensive than in The Hague.
Transport in Bochum is 30% cheaper than in The Hague.
